Output 3368940094990447c2ce80e352189f5376742a50add8a51d24dc2a51af6c4bbc:87

value
124658
script pubkey
OP_0 OP_PUSHBYTES_20 2c12f2dba3a4ae3a3b6a9e38b2793add6fe0b957
address
bc1q9sf09kar5jhr5wm2ncuty7f6m4h7pw2h97d8ny
transaction
3368940094990447c2ce80e352189f5376742a50add8a51d24dc2a51af6c4bbc
spent
true